The Territory

Along the 121 main road, heading in the direction of Palermo, you come to Villarosa, a small town built by Duke Placido Notarbartolo on the ruins of a farmhouse which was destroyed by an earthquake in 1693. The town went through a prosperous period in the 19th century, with the exploitation of the numerous sulphur mines in the area. Its orthogonal plan, draw up by the painter Rosa Ciotti di Resuttano, allows for a smooth tour through the ordely streets in the town. Among its more interesting monuments, the 18th century main church dedicated to San Giacomo Maggiore and Palazzo Ducale are both worth seeing. Your visit to Villarosa however, begins before the residential area. On the 121 main road, you will come to the cut-off for the railway station on your left.It is worthwhile taking the detour. A small country station, destined to be closed, has been skilfully trasformed into a extremely original railway and rural museum. Another detour leads to Lake Morello, an artificial basin into which the river Morello is made to flow. The lake basin offers landscapes of considerable natural interest.
